WebFingernails and toenails are derived from the stratum corneum. They serve a protective function and can be used as tools. The stratum corneum, or horny layer, of the epidermis … A nail is a flattish claw-like plate at the tip of the fingers and toes which is characteristically found on all primates. Nails correspond to the claws found in other animals. Fingernails and toenails are made of a tough protective protein called alpha-keratin, which is a polymer. Alpha-keratin is found in the hooves, claws, and horns of vertebrates. WebAs epidermal cells below the nail root move up to the surface of the skin, they increase in number. Those closest to the nail root get flat and pressed tightly together. Each cell becomes a thin plate; these plates pile into layers to form the nail. As with hair, nails form by keratinization. WebThe nail body forms at the nail root, which has a matrix of proliferating cells from the stratum basale that enables the nail to grow continuously. The lateral nail fold overlaps the nail on the sides, helping to anchor the nail body. The nail fold that meets the proximal end of the nail body forms the nail cuticle, also called the eponychium. WebFeb 14, 2024 · The portion of the nail bed that sits at the base of the nail plate is called the nail matrix. The nail matrix contains nerves and blood vessels, and it gives rise to nail plate cells at the root of the nail. As the nail grows, new nail plate cells in the nail root push older cells up the nail plate.
